Welcome to Shimla, the capital city of Himachal Pradesh! Begin your adventure by exploring the streets of this picturesque hill station in the morning. Take a leisurely walk along Mall Road, lined with charming shops and cafes, and enjoy the panoramic views of the surrounding mountains. In the afternoon, visit the Viceregal Lodge, an architectural marvel that once served as the summer residence of the British viceroys. As the evening sets in, indulge in some local delicacies at one of the popular restaurants in Shimla.
Embark on a scenic drive to Sarahan, a charming village known for its centuries-old Bhimakali Temple. Spend the morning exploring the temple complex and admiring the intricate wooden carvings. Afterward, continue your journey to Sangla Valley, a hidden gem nestled in the Himalayas. In the afternoon, visit the Kamru Fort, perched atop a hill with panoramic vistas of the valley. Enjoy a leisurely stroll through the quaint villages of Sangla and interact with the friendly locals. In the evening, relax by the Baspa River and soak in the serene atmosphere.
Head to the beautiful village of Kalpa in the morning, known for its stunning views of the snow-capped Kinnaur Kailash range. Take a walk through the apple orchards and marvel at the traditional Kinnauri architecture. Afterward, continue your journey to Nako, a small village located at an altitude of 3,662 meters. Explore the ancient Nako Monastery and enjoy the tranquility of the Nako Lake. In the evening, witness the breathtaking sunset over the Himalayas from the vantage point near the village.
On your final day, visit the historic Tabo Monastery, often referred to as the "Ajanta of the Himalayas." Explore the ancient caves, murals, and statues that adorn this UNESCO World Heritage Site. In the afternoon, continue your journey to Dhankar, a village perched on a rocky spur overlooking the confluence of Spiti and Pin Rivers. Visit the Dhankar Monastery, a prominent Buddhist site, and hike up to the Dhankar Lake for breathtaking views of the surrounding landscapes. As the day comes to an end, bid farewell to the enchanting Kinnaur Spiti and start your journey back home.
While exploring Kinnaur Spiti, make sure to visit the picturesque village of Chitkul, located on the Indo-Tibetan border. With its quaint wooden houses, gushing streams, and magnificent mountain views, Chitkul offers a truly unforgettable experience. Another hidden gem is the Pin Valley National Park, known for its diverse flora and fauna. Take a trek through this pristine wilderness and spot rare Himalayan wildlife such as snow leopards and ibex. Don't forget to try the delicious local cuisines like Tibetan momos, thukpa, and Himachali dham during your trip.
